    How long to receive the USFA mebership card and key FOB?

    I sent my membership application and payment in on Aug 1. I can see that they have me listed in their current membership listings at usfencing.org. I have a competition coming up in mid October so I wanted to have the card on me (although I'm fencing at my home club and they know I'm a member).

    How long does it normally take to get your ID card? Thanks in advance!

    Seems like I got mine a couple weeks or less after initial (re)enrollment. When I sent an email requesting a division change, I received the new stuff in less than a week.

    Regardless, tourney folk can look up your name on the usfa website to verify enrollment. Wouldn't hurt to print that page, but I doubt it'd be a problem at the tourney.

    I sent in my application and payment (via snail mail) on 8/17 and got my card last week. I think my card showed up 2-3 weeks after my name showed up on the website.

    As long as you have the membership number, I wouldn't be worried about actually having the card.

    You can now print out your membership "card" online on your own printer through the USFA website.
